Home
last modified time | relevance | path

Searched refs:SETBUSY (Results 1 – 4 of 4) sorted by relevance

/illumos-gate/usr/src/lib/libmalloc/common/
H A Dmalloc.c284 ((struct header *)((char *)alloc_buf - minhead))->nextblk = SETBUSY(hd); in memalign()
533 newend->nextblk = SETBUSY(&(arena[1])); in malloc_unlocked()
542 arenaend->nextblk = SETBUSY(newblk); in malloc_unlocked()
562 newend->nextblk = SETBUSY(&(arena[1])); in malloc_unlocked()
584 newend->nextblk = SETBUSY(&(arena[1])); in malloc_unlocked()
610 blk->nextblk = SETBUSY(newblk); in malloc_unlocked()
617 blk->nextblk = SETBUSY(blk->nextblk); in malloc_unlocked()
786 blk->nextblk = SETBUSY(next); in realloc_unlocked()
795 blk->nextblk = SETBUSY(next); in realloc_unlocked()
817 blk->nextblk = SETBUSY(newblk); in realloc_unlocked()
H A Dmallint.h139 #define SETBUSY(x) ((struct header *)((long)(x) | BUSY)) macro
/illumos-gate/usr/src/contrib/ast/src/lib/libast/vmalloc/
H A Dvmhdr.h175 #define SETBUSY(w) ((w) |= BUSY) macro
H A Dvmbest.c703 SETBUSY(SIZE(tp));